sys/kern/uipc_usrreq.c
Sat, 22 May 2004 22:52:13 +0000 jonathan Eliminate several uses of `curproc' from the socket-layer code and from NFS. trunk
Sun, 18 Apr 2004 22:20:32 +0000 matt Constify sun_noname. trunk
Sun, 18 Apr 2004 21:48:15 +0000 matt ANSI'fy. trunk
Sat, 17 Apr 2004 15:15:29 +0000 christos PR/9347: Eric E. Fair: socket buffer pool exhaustion leads to system deadlock trunk
Tue, 23 Mar 2004 13:22:03 +0000 junyoung Nuke __P(). trunk
Mon, 29 Dec 2003 22:08:02 +0000 martin Avoid using m_clget() on a mbuf already in use, especially when we trunk
Sat, 29 Nov 2003 10:02:42 +0000 matt Restore a change that made AF_LOCAL sockets block on connect(2) until trunk
Sat, 29 Nov 2003 06:08:29 +0000 perry Revert a change that altered the semantics of AF_LOCAL sockets. Sadly trunk
Wed, 15 Oct 2003 11:28:59 +0000 hannken Add the gating of system calls that cause modifications to the underlying trunk
Wed, 03 Sep 2003 22:20:34 +0000 matt Fix typo. trunk
Wed, 03 Sep 2003 21:30:12 +0000 matt Change the behavor of AF_LOCAL connect() to sleep until the server has trunk
Thu, 07 Aug 2003 16:26:28 +0000 agc Move UCB-licensed code from 4-clause to 3-clause licence. trunk
Thu, 24 Jul 2003 07:30:48 +0000 jdolecek back rev 1.63 (the linux hack) off - no compat specific code trunk
Wed, 23 Jul 2003 22:17:54 +0000 itojun backout previous, there was a comment on LINUX_SOL_SOCKET=1 trunk
Wed, 23 Jul 2003 21:42:31 +0000 itojun #define LINUX_SOL_SOCKET 1, so that we can answer "what the hell is this 1?" trunk
Wed, 23 Jul 2003 19:24:48 +0000 christos From Todd Vierling: Accept level == 1 for linux compat. trunk
Sun, 29 Jun 2003 22:28:00 +0000 fvdl Back out the lwp/ktrace changes. They contained a lot of colateral damage, trunk
Sat, 28 Jun 2003 14:20:43 +0000 darrenr Pass lwp pointers throughtout the kernel, as required, so that the lwpid can trunk
Thu, 10 Apr 2003 18:55:11 +0000 christos RP/21088: Jesse Off: Return ENOBUFS instead of EINVAL when sbappend fails. trunk
Wed, 26 Feb 2003 06:31:08 +0000 matt Add MBUFTRACE kernel option. trunk
Tue, 25 Feb 2003 09:56:15 +0000 pk Fix a simple_lock() mismatch in unp_internalize(). trunk
Sun, 23 Feb 2003 14:37:32 +0000 pk Make updating a file's reference and use count MP-safe. trunk
Mon, 25 Nov 2002 08:31:58 +0000 itojun no need for error check after MEXTMALLOC - jdolecek trunk
Mon, 25 Nov 2002 06:32:37 +0000 itojun MEXTMALLOC() can fail even if M_WAITOK, if arg is too big for malloc(). trunk
Wed, 04 Sep 2002 01:32:31 +0000 matt Use the queue macros from <sys/queue.h> instead of referring to the queue trunk
Mon, 12 Nov 2001 15:25:01 +0000 lukem add RCSIDs trunk
Thu, 18 Oct 2001 20:17:24 +0000 thorpej Deprecate the "m_act" alias of "m_nextpkt" (m_act is a historical trunk
Thu, 14 Jun 2001 20:32:41 +0000 thorpej Fix a partial construction problem that can cause race conditions trunk
Thu, 07 Jun 2001 01:29:16 +0000 thorpej Rework fdalloc() even further: split fdalloc() into fdalloc() and trunk
Wed, 06 Jun 2001 17:00:00 +0000 thorpej Change fdalloc() to return ERESTART if we had to reallocate the trunk
Mon, 05 Jun 2000 16:29:45 +0000 thorpej Oops, missed a couple of places where CMSG_*() should be used. No trunk
Mon, 05 Jun 2000 06:06:07 +0000 thorpej - Fix file descriptor passing AGAIN. This has apparently been broken trunk
Thu, 30 Mar 2000 09:27:11 +0000 augustss Get rid of register declarations. trunk
Thu, 17 Jun 1999 23:17:45 +0000 thorpej Um, hi, let's initialize pointers before we use them. trunk
Wed, 05 May 1999 20:01:01 +0000 thorpej Add "use counting" to file entries. When closing a file, and it's reference trunk
Wed, 05 May 1999 19:05:43 +0000 thorpej Fix alignment problem in the garbage-collection code path. trunk
Fri, 30 Apr 1999 18:42:58 +0000 thorpej Break cdir/rdir/cmask info out of struct filedesc, and put it in a new trunk
Wed, 21 Apr 1999 02:37:07 +0000 mrg revert previous. oops. trunk
Wed, 21 Apr 1999 02:31:49 +0000 mrg properly test the msgsz as "msgsz - len". from PR#7386 trunk
Mon, 22 Mar 1999 17:54:38 +0000 sommerfe Disallow descriptor-passing of descriptors which are open on trunk
Mon, 21 Dec 1998 23:12:19 +0000 thorpej In unp_internalize(), add a comment explaining why we must ALIGN() the trunk
Mon, 21 Dec 1998 23:03:02 +0000 thorpej Fix a fencepost error in unp_scan() which caused a bad pointer deref on trunk
Tue, 04 Aug 1998 04:03:10 +0000 perry Abolition of bcopy, ovbcopy, bcmp, and bzero, phase one. trunk
Fri, 31 Jul 1998 22:50:48 +0000 perry fix sizeofs so they comply with the KNF style guide. yes, it is pedantic. trunk
Sat, 18 Jul 1998 05:04:35 +0000 lukem use AF_LOCAL instead of AF_UNIX trunk
Thu, 16 Jul 1998 00:46:50 +0000 thorpej Back out previous, I botched something. trunk
Fri, 10 Jul 1998 22:15:47 +0000 thorpej For SOCK_STREAM, provide the socket credentials to the accepter as soon as trunk
Sun, 01 Mar 1998 02:20:01 +0000 fvdl Merge with Lite2 + local changes trunk
Wed, 07 Jan 1998 22:57:09 +0000 thorpej Implement passing credentials as ancillary data on Unix domain sockets, trunk
Wed, 07 Jan 1998 04:03:38 +0000 thorpej Fix passing of multiple file descriptors (was broken when code was made trunk
Fri, 17 Oct 1997 17:35:08 +0000 christos PR/4280: Chris Jones: Sending more than one fd over AF_UNIX sockets causes trunk
Thu, 26 Jun 1997 06:06:40 +0000 thorpej Several small changes to eliminate kludginess in dealing with unix domain trunk
Tue, 24 Jun 1997 19:12:53 +0000 thorpej Eliminate use of dtom() in the handing of UNIX domain sockets. Add an trunk
Thu, 15 May 1997 17:01:04 +0000 kleink When fstat(2)ing a file descriptor of a local communications domain socket, trunk
Thu, 10 Apr 1997 01:51:21 +0000 cgd Internalize and externalize file descriptors being passed via local domain trunk
Thu, 23 May 1996 17:07:03 +0000 mycroft Oops. Add missing label. trunk
Thu, 23 May 1996 16:49:08 +0000 mycroft We can only get a control mbuf for PRU_SEND or PRU_SENDOOB. Add diagnostic trunk
Thu, 23 May 1996 16:41:49 +0000 mycroft Make sure the control and data mbufs are freed in all cases. trunk
Thu, 23 May 1996 16:03:45 +0000 mycroft Separate some code into separate functions. trunk
Wed, 22 May 1996 13:54:55 +0000 mycroft Pass a proc pointer down to the usrreq and pcbbind functions for PRU_ATTACH, PRU_BIND and trunk
less more (0) -60 tip